The Argentinean Congreso de la Nacion (National Congress, or Parliament) approved in November 2010 a new Mental Health Law (MHL) ([http://servicios.infoleg.gob.ar/infolegInternet/anexos/175000-179999/175977/norma.htm Law 26657, ‘Salud Publica. Derecho a la Proteccion de la Salud Mental’] [Public Health. The Right to Protect Mental Health]) ([http://iah.salud.gob.ar/doc/Documento224.pdf PDF])
